  • LOME, TOGO -  13-01-10   - A journalist reacts to tear gas. Shortly after gathering for the first in three days of planned demonstrations, protesters clashed with police in Lome, Togo on January 10. Opposition groups are calling for the resignation of President Faure Gnassingbe, whose family has been in power for over 40 years.   Photo by Daniel Hayduk
